Transaction 58930d596f837e003be760c0bbbd099b65eb524064de14bce144581007488f44
1 Input
1 Output
-
58930d596f837e003be760c0bbbd099b65eb524064de14bce144581007488f44:0
- value
- 954044
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5049077566a46ceba14b752b3c7c1c3847264155 OP_EQUAL
- address
- 391XU3URuMHKdkQ3its34yfrJieGR6cco5